Why Thanking God for the Year Ending Matters
Most people rush into a new year without properly closing the old one. They make resolutions without taking inventory. They set goals without gratitude. That is a mistake. Thanking God for the year ending is not optional. It is essential spiritual hygiene. You cannot receive what comes next without honoring what came before. Gratitude completes the loop. It acknowledges that every breath you took this year was a gift. Every meal. Every conversation. Every sunrise. All of them came from the same generous hand. When you thank God for the year, you also heal unfinished business. Unforgiveness festers in ungrateful hearts. Bitterness grows where thanks is absent. Thanksgiving roots out those weeds. It softens hard places. It opens your hands to receive again.
Another reason this prayer matters involves perspective. A year is too long to remember clearly. Your brain highlights the bad and forgets the good. That is a survival mechanism gone wrong. Intentional gratitude rewires that default setting. When you pray 399 prayers of thanks, you force your memory to search for evidence of God’s goodness. You find it everywhere. The small kindness you forgot. The prayer answered in a way you did not expect. The disaster that almost happened but did not. Thanksgiving opens your eyes. Then you walk into the new year seeing clearly.
How to Use These 399 Prayers
You do not need to pray all 399 at once. Spread them out over the final days of the year. Pray ten each morning. Pray twenty on New Year’s Eve. Let the reflection last. Each prayer targets a different aspect of the past year. Some focus on specific blessings like health, family, and work. Others address hard things like loss, failure, and disappointment. Do not skip the hard prayers. Thanksgiving in the midst of pain is the deepest kind of worship. Say those prayers slowly. Let them hurt a little. That hurt is the gateway to healing.
Consider journaling alongside these prayers. Write down what comes to mind when you pray each number. Did a specific memory surface? Write it down. Did a name appear in your thoughts? Pray for that person. Did you feel convicted about something? Confess it. Journaling turns these prayers from a recitation into a conversation. Take your time. The year took twelve months to unfold. Give it a few days to close properly.
